About the Company:

RDO Equipment is one of the world’s largest and most trusted John Deere and Vermeer equipment dealers, selling and supporting John Deere Construction & Forestry, and Agricultural & Turf machinery, as well as the full range of Vermeer equipment. RDO proudly employs more than 1,000 staff, and operates out of 34 locations in metro and regional Australia, providing parts and service support for the agricultural, roads, civil construction, landscaping, mining and forestry sectors.

About the Role:

Our Emerald branch is looking for an experienced and driven Service Manager who will manage a large team and provide support to our valued customers.


The key responsibilities of this role will include but not limited to:

  • Efficiently manage & direct all aspects of the workshop operations.
  • Ensure the highest level of service is provided to our customer base.
  • Ensure delivery of key performance indicators including productivity, efficiency, rework, WIP and Billing Cycle
  • Manage a workforce of up to 25 staff including apprentices.
  • Provide leadership, guidance & training to the service team.
  • Continuously develop & implement strategies to improve maintenance & service effectiveness.


You will bring the following skills and experience to the role:

  • Extensive experience in a management position within a workshop environment with Agricultural machinery.
  • Proven ability to build relationships with customers, fellow work colleagues and management.
  • Strong leadership skills including outstanding communication (verbal and written) and motivational skills.
  • Financial management including managing budgets.
  • Ability to evaluate and assess operations and respond to changing needs.
  • Strong computer skills

Trade or tertiary qualifications are highly recommended & advantageous but not essential.
